Compressor Assembly Removal and Installation: Removal

- Run engine at idle speed with A/C ON for 10 minutes.
- Stop the engine.
- Disconnect negative (-) cable from battery.
- Recover refrigerant from the A/C system with recovery and recycling equipment referring to "RECOVERY " in OPERATION PROCEDURE FOR REFRIGERANT CHARGE: MANUAL A/C .
- Remove condenser cooling fan referring to CONDENSER COOLING FAN REMOVAL AND INSTALLATION: MANUAL A/C .
- Remove compressor drive belt referring to ACCESSORY DRIVE BELT REMOVAL AND INSTALLATION .
- Remove right side engine under cover.
- Disconnect magnet clutch lead wire coupler (1).
- Disconnect discharge hose (2) and suction hose (3) from compressor (4).NOTE: Cap open fittings immediately to keep moisture out of the system.
- Remove compressor mounting bolts (1), and then remove compressor (2).
